怎么开发发布app

hboxs 3个月前 (01-14) 阅读数 3313 #APP开发
文章标签 开发发布app
微信号:hboxs7
添加项目经理微信 获取更多优惠
复制微信号

如何开发和发布APP

开发和发布一款APP是一个复杂而系统的过程,通常可以分为几个主要阶段:需求分析、设计、开发、测试、发布和后期维护。以下是详细的步骤和注意事项。

需求分析

在开发APP之前,首先需要明确应用的目标和功能需求。这一阶段包括:

  • 确定目标用户:了解你的目标用户是谁,他们的需求和痛点是什么。
  • 功能需求:列出APP需要实现的核心功能,并进行优先级排序。
  • 市场调研:分析竞争对手的产品,了解市场趋势和用户反馈,以便更好地定位自己的APP。

设计阶段

设计是APP开发中至关重要的一步,主要包括:

  • 用户界面(UI)设计:使用工具如Sketch、Figma等进行界面设计,确保界面美观且易于使用。
  • 用户体验(UX)设计:设计用户交互流程,确保用户在使用APP时的流畅体验。

开发阶段

开发阶段是将设计转化为实际产品的过程,通常分为前端和后端开发:

  • 前端开发:实现用户界面和用户交互,使用技术如HTML、CSS、JavaScript等。
  • 后端开发:处理数据存储和业务逻辑,使用语言如Java、Python、Node.js等。

在这一阶段,开发者需要遵循良好的编程规范,确保代码的可读性和可维护性。

测试阶段

测试是确保APP质量的重要环节,主要包括:

  • 功能测试:验证APP的各项功能是否正常工作。
  • 性能测试:评估APP在不同负载下的表现。
  • 兼容性测试:确保APP在不同设备和操作系统上的兼容性。

可以使用自动化测试工具(如Appium、XCTest等)来提高测试效率。

发布阶段

发布是将APP推向市场的关键步骤,主要包括:

  • 打包APP:根据目标平台的要求,使用工具如Xcode(iOS)或Android Studio(Android)打包APP。
  • 提交审核:将APP提交到应用商店(如Apple App Store或Google Play Store),并遵循各自的审核流程。
  • 准备发布资料:包括应用图标、截图、描述信息等,确保这些资料符合应用商店的要求。

后期维护

发布后,开发者需要持续关注用户反馈,进行版本更新和功能优化,以适应市场变化和用户需求。

深度扩展:开发和发布APP的相关延伸

开发和发布APP不仅仅是技术上的挑战,还涉及到市场营销、用户获取和数据分析等多个方面。

市场营销策略

在APP发布后,如何让用户知道并下载你的APP是一个重要问题。可以考虑以下策略:

  • 社交媒体推广:利用社交媒体平台(如微博、微信、抖音等)进行宣传,吸引目标用户。
  • 内容营销:通过撰写相关领域的博客文章或制作视频内容,吸引用户关注。
  • 应用商店优化(ASO):优化APP在应用商店的排名,包括关键词选择、应用描述和用户评价等。

用户获取与留存

获取用户后,如何留住他们同样重要。可以通过以下方式提高用户留存率:

  • 用户反馈机制:建立用户反馈渠道,及时收集和处理用户意见。
  • 定期更新:根据用户反馈和市场需求,定期推出新功能和优化版本。
  • 用户激励:通过积分、优惠券等方式激励用户使用APP,增加用户粘性。

数据分析

数据分析是优化APP的重要工具。通过分析用户行为数据,可以了解用户的使用习惯和偏好,从而进行针对性的改进。常用的分析工具包括Google Analytics、Firebase等。

法律合规

在开发和发布APP时,遵循相关法律法规是必不可少的。例如,在处理用户数据时,需要遵循GDPR等隐私保护法律,确保用户信息的安全和隐私。

结论

开发和发布一款成功的APP需要全面的规划和执行,从需求分析到后期维护,每个环节都至关重要。通过合理的市场营销策略、用户获取与留存措施,以及数据分析,开发者可以不断优化APP,提升用户体验,最终实现商业目标。

版权声明

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!

作者文章
热门
最新文章